In the Garden: The Invasion of the Furry Caterpillar

November 30, 2020 by Amber Harmon

So who are these pesky, little furry caterpillars that have invaded our yards, cars, and hair? They are called fall webworms, and they turn into moths. If you haven’t seen them yet, I bet you will.
